The Basics of Title Loans in Woodlake, Texas
Also known as car title loans, auto title loans, or pink slip loans, title loans provide a quick and easy way to access cash when you’re in a bind. The legality of title loans varies significantly from state to state. In Texas, title loans are legal and widely used. As long as you have a lien-free vehicle and a government-issued ID, you can apply for a title loan in Woodlake, Texas, and get quick approval.
When you apply for a title loan, the lender appraises your vehicle and determines its market value. Typically, the loan amount you’ll qualify for is a percentage of your car’s value; in Texas, that value can be up to 80% of the vehicle’s total worth. The borrower usually has to repay the loan within a specific time frame (usually 30 days, or up to several months), plus interest and fees.

The Risks of Title Loans in Woodlake, Texas
Like any other type of loan, title loans come with risks. First and foremost, the interest rates on title loans are usually very high, often reaching triple digits. This can make it difficult to pay back the loan, especially if you have a limited income. Moreover, if you fail to repay the loan, the lender can repossess your vehicle and sell it to recover the amount owed plus interest and fees.
It’s also important to note that there are many unscrupulous lenders out there who take advantage of borrowers. They may offer loans with exorbitant interest rates or make false promises to convince you to take out a title loan. Interesting Facts and Statistics about Title Loans in Woodlake, Texas
- According to the Texas Office of Consumer Credit Commissioner, almost 255,000 Texans took out title loans in 2020.
- The total value of title loans in Texas was over $1.2 billion in 2020.
- The average title loan amount in Texas was $1,042, with an average term of 308 days.
